Facility therapy dogs are trained to work with individuals or groups of people in a facility setting. Facility therapy dogs have “jobs” within their departments where they come to work every day and work with patients.

About Frazier Rehab Institute
Over the past six decades, UofL Health – Frazier Rehabiliation Institute has built a reputation as the regional leader in comprehensive acute rehab. The 135-bed state-of-the-art inpatient facility in downtown Louisville offers specialized programs for brain injuries, movement disorders, spinal cord medicine, stroke recovery, and pediatrics. From onset to recovery, our goal is to help patients reach their greatest potential.
